"mergeinto"通常用于将一个数据结构合并到另一个数据结构中,并且通常会覆盖相同键的值。这意味着如果目标数据结构已经包含相同键的值,那么"mergeinto"会将源数据结构的值覆盖目标数据结构的值。
与此相"> "mergeinto"通常用于将一个数据结构合并到另一个数据结构中,并且通常会覆盖相同键的值。这意味着如果目标数据结构已经包含相同键的值,那么"mergeinto"会将源数据结构的值覆盖目标数据结构的值。
与此相">
117.info
人生若只如初见

mergeinto能否替代insert

在某些情况下,“mergeinto"可以替代"insert”,但二者并不完全等价。

"mergeinto"通常用于将一个数据结构合并到另一个数据结构中,并且通常会覆盖相同键的值。这意味着如果目标数据结构已经包含相同键的值,那么"mergeinto"会将源数据结构的值覆盖目标数据结构的值。

与此相比,"insert"通常用于将一个新值插入到数据结构中,如果数据结构已经包含相同键的值,则"insert"可能会抛出异常或者不执行插入操作。

因此,在需要合并两个数据结构并且可能存在相同键的情况下,可以考虑使用"mergeinto";而在只需要将新值插入到数据结构中的情况下,则应该使用"insert"。两者的选择取决于具体的应用场景和需求。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fee7dAzsIAgVTBlQ.html

推荐文章

  • mergeinto和update有什么区别

    mergeinto和update都是数据库操作语句,但它们之间有一些区别。 mergeinto:mergeinto语句用于将两个表中的数据合并在一起。它会将源表中的数据合并到目标表中,...

  • mergeinto用法有什么技巧

    使用mergeinto技巧时,需要注意以下几点: 确保两个要合并的内容具有一定的相关性和相似性,以确保合并后的内容能够流畅地过渡。
    在进行合并之前,先对内容...

  • mergeinto是否支持所有数据库

    mergeinto是一个SQL命令,用于将两个表或视图合并为一个。不是所有数据库管理系统都支持mergeinto命令,这取决于具体的数据库管理系统。一些主流的数据库管理系统...

  • 如何理解mergeinto的语法

    mergeinto的语法通常表示将一个元素合并到另一个元素中,通常用于描述操作或函数的功能。例如:
    list1 = [1, 2, 3]
    list2 = [4, 5, 6] list1.mergeint...

  • 使用mergeinto时的常见错误

    忘记指定源对象和目标对象:在使用mergeInto时,需要指定一个源对象和一个目标对象,否则会出现错误。 类型不匹配:源对象和目标对象的类型必须相同或兼容,否则...

  • mergeinto对数据库有何影响

    Merge into是一种用于将数据合并到数据库表中的SQL语句。当使用Merge into语句时,数据库会根据指定的条件判断是否应该插入新的数据,更新现有数据或者删除数据。...

  • mergeinto适用于哪些场景

    mergeinto通常适用于以下场景: 当两个相似的页面内容重复时,可以使用mergeinto将它们合并成一个页面,以避免重复内容。
    当某个页面内容较少,与其他页面内...

  • 如何优化mergeinto操作

    要优化mergeinto操作,可以采取以下几种方法: 使用合适的数据结构:选择适合mergeinto操作的数据结构,例如使用堆、平衡二叉树等数据结构来存储数据,可以提高m...